Development of a high-gradient magnetic separator for …

The magnetic force acting on a spherical particle of radius R in a magnetic field H is satisfactorily given by Eq. (1) [14]. (1) F → m = 4 3 π R 3 μ 0 χH ∇ H → where μ 0 is the permeability of vacuum, and χ is the difference between the volume magnetic susceptibility of the particle and the surrounding fluid (air, water, or paramagnetic liquid). …

High Gradient Magnetic Separator For Silica Sand | GTEK

The color of quartz sand is also different due to the different impurities contained. For example, because of the impurities such as titanium and iron, it is brownish red or light yellow.The Mohs hardness of quartz is generally 7, and the refractoriness is 1650~1770℃, specific gravity 2.65~2.66, refractive index 1.533~1.541.

Magnetic separation for mining industry – Magnetense

This type of magnetic separation machine is used in wet separation processes for smaller than 1,2 mm ( – 200 mesh of 30-100 %) of fine grained red mine (hematite) limonite, manganese ore, ilmenite and some kinds of weakly magnetic minerals like quartz, feldspar, nepheline ore and kaolin in order to remove impurity iron and to purify them.
